Are checking out the reviews on here and the fact they could accomodate our dog we booked a mid week stay for 1 night. I chose the new river view room downstairs which was doggy friendly. The location was lovely, arriving early we set off from the main car park in Malham and walked to Janets Foss a lovely waterfall then on to Gordale Scar then Malham Cove. After the walk we found our hotel and parking in teir roomy car park crossed the charming bridge to sit outside Beck Hall and have afternoon tea. We were they shown our room which was lovely with a nice view of the river. The four poster bed was very comfy and the bathroom nice although no bath, but that wasnt a problem for us. A good supply of tea, coffee, chocolate and biscuits were provided. Only thing I will mention as a slight problem was the TV on the wall could not be moved in such a way that we could both see it from the bed, I had a post in the way from the bed!. A short walk away and we found the Lister arms were we enjoyed an evening meal, they even allowed our dog to dine with us. Breakfast was ok with them setting up a table in the lounge so our dog could sit with us. Checkout was no problem, they dont charge extra for dogs but welcome a £1 donation per dog for extra cleaning . Overall a charming B & B, we will deffinately stay again.

having read all the reviews, and deciding that the good reviews outweighed the negative reports we decided that it looked like our sort of place take a look at the video,what you see is what you get,quite peaceful surroundings and a chance to chill out and relax. we stayed in the green room complete with four poster bed and no tv! which all added to the feel of less hectic times. we both found the owners to be very pleasant and helpful breakfasts were both large and well cooked with plenty of choice malham has two pubs both offering food ,we tried the buck inn and found it to be very good with huge portions of well cooked food, can`t comment on the lister ph as we never tried it . enjoyed it so much that we have booked to go again in april.

We stayed at Beck Hall for one night. It was excellent. We had a room in the new Annex (which will allow for the opportunity to refurbish some of the other rooms).

The property verges on being a small hotel now with the annex but still has much of the coziness of a B&B. That said, it's certainly NOT an hotel ... Having stayed in falling apart budget hotels in the UK charging comparable prices especially after you add the cost of breakfast, you realize this is very reasonable. There is an expectation that B&Bs should be comparable in price to budget hotels ... but people seem to forget the &B. One popular chain charges nearly 8 pounds per head for a meagre breakfast. That quickly makes the B&B cheaper and staying at Beck Hall was no exception.

The room was clean, bright and comfortable, overlooking the brook. The bed extremely comfortable, and I soon know if I get a bad bad! Most hotels offer inroom tea and coffee. Beck Hall adds hot chocoloate to the list.

Breakfast was either cold (cereal / yogourt / fruit) or the traditional English which I opted for (Hold the fried bread!) The sausages were absolutely delicious and complemented a well presented plate. Toast (wholewheat and white) with marmalade rounded off the meal with a nice cup of coffee.

The location on the "other side of the brook" (which becomes the River AIr) was a bit odd with the parking lot in the non-obvious location, and the stone bridge was a bit frightening with a 36 lb suitcase! We inadvertantly went to the wrong building and upset a neighbour. Clearly the neighbour's doors need signs saying "Not Beck Hall".

Simon and Alice go a long way to accomodate the needs of the guests.

With the main part of the hall a 17th century building built partly into the hillside, maintenance is always going to be a problem, but that's what makes B&Bs an adventure. Sure better than a Travelodge!

Stayed at the Beck Hall, after finally finding it - Not the Beck Hall's fault at all - my Sat Nav had taken me to Airton down the road, despite putting in the postcode correctly.

That said, the 2 night stay here has been excellent! We were given the Wharfe room, which though slightly on the small side, had a 4-poster bed, modern bathroom with power-shower and walkin wardrobe, spotlessly clean, in-room tea/coffee making facility and with a flat screen LCD TV with SKY channels (albeit, only the free channels). The Beck Hall also offers FREE Wifi internet connection & an honesty bar - and lets face it, there's not may places that do these days are there.

You seem only to be able to pick up 'Orange' mobile phone signal up here and the roads around these parts can be quite narrow and windy, so best not to bring a large car (as I did, doh!) and take care when driving as walkers are out and about.

The proprietors, Simon and his wife, as well as the room service girls are most welcoming and pleasand and they try hard to make your stay as pleasant as posible. Breakfast was well cooked and caters for most, including vegetarians.

I'd highly recommend the Beck Hall for anyone wanting to explore the Malhamdale area. A beautiful area of the country, and Beck Hall is the perfect place to stay, for all ages.

We found Beck Hall to be brilliant and I was surprised to see what others have written below.

The three nights we stayed were relaxing from start to finish. The room we had was lovely although it was the green room (the blue and green rooms seem to be highly rated).

The log fire in the lounge is lovely and the honesty bar makes it very welcoming (I would still recommend dinner and drinks at the Lister Arms for anyone visiting Malham).

The full english breakfast was lovely. It was also very useful that they were able to cater for my wife who is a coeliac (gluten intolerant), which is rare. We didn't feel inclined to try the evenings meals, mainly because of the Lister Arms' appeal.
